After a string of shows last month, the new quintet featuring Jimmy Herring, Bobby Lee Rodgers, Jeff Sipe, Neal Fountain and Mark Van Allen will reconnect for gigs throughout the month of August. The quintet has spent some time working up original material with a studio recording and additional touring to follow as well. The one thing that band lacks is a fitting moniker. The group has been touring as Herring/Rodgers/Sipe, which may fill the marquee but doesnt even reflect all of the band members. As a result, the group is encouraging wordsmiths to offer up their own suggestions. The band is soliciting these on its MySpace page, pledging a prize to anyone who supplies the winning appellation (note: Herring/Rodgers/Sipe/Fountain/Van Allen likely wont cut it).
